    The history of the Mozambique 1 Escudo coin takes us back to a time when Mozambique was part of Portugal's overseas territories. Portuguese colonial rule had a profound impact on the nation, influencing its culture, economy, and governance. This coin was an integral part of the monetary system during that era, symbolizing Mozambique's place within the Portuguese empire.

    The Almost Uncirculated (AU) condition assigned to this coin signifies that it exhibits minimal wear, reflecting its limited circulation. While some traces of wear may be visible, especially on high points of the coin, the overall design remains well-defined, and the coin retains much of its original luster. Coins in AU condition are highly prized by collectors for their historical significance and well-preserved appearance.
